Objectives
The Congress operates following these objectives
To provide a cohesive structure through which the Ontario Chapters can work effectively.
To research and provide relevant information regarding issues which affect black women and their families.
To provide a non-threatening forum through which Black Women can express their views and seek support.
To facilitate cooperation among the chapters.
To enhance the effectiveness of the chapters by providing leadership and organizational skills
To strengthen the chapter through commitment and accountability to the region and the national executive
To promote the Congress by building relationship with government agencies, other organizations and community resources.
To heighten visibility of the work of the Congress throughout the province.
